英语解释

名词 humor:

  1. a message whose ingenuity or verbal skill or incongruity has the power to evoke laughter同义词:wit, humour, witticism, wittiness
  2. the trait of appreciating (and being able to express) the humorous同义词:humour, sense of humor, sense of humour
  3. a characteristic (habitual or relatively temporary) state of feeling同义词:temper, mood, humour
  4. the quality of being funny同义词:humour
  5. (Middle Ages) one of the four fluids in the body whose balance was believed to determine your emotional and physical state同义词:humour
  6. the liquid parts of the body同义词:liquid body substance, bodily fluid, body fluid, humour

动词 humor:

  1. put into a good mood同义词:humour

详细解释


hu.mor
n.(名词)The quality that makes something laughable or amusing; funniness:诙谐,滑稽:使某事物可笑或者有趣的属性;诙谐:例句:could not see the humor of the situation.没有看过比这更滑稽的场面了
That which is intended to induce laughter or amusement:幽默,风趣:故意逗笑或使人感兴趣的东西:例句:a writer skilled at crafting humor.作家展现他的幽默技巧
The ability to perceive, enjoy, or express what is amusing, comical, incongruous, or absurd.See Synonyms at wit 幽默感:看出、享受或表达有趣的、喜剧性的、离奇的或荒谬的东西的能力参见 witOne of the four fluids of the body, blood, phlegm, choler, and black bile, whose relative proportions were thought in ancient physiology to determine a person`s disposition and general health.基本的体液:血液、粘液、胆汁和黑胆汁四种体液之一,古代生理学家认为它们的相对比例决定一个人的性情和健康状况Physiology 【生理学】 A body fluid, such as blood, lymph, or bile.体液:一种体液,如血液、淋巴液或胆汁Aqueous humor.水汁液Vitreous humor.玻璃液A person`s characteristic disposition or temperament:气质,性格:一个人典型的性情或脾气:例句:a boy of sullen humor.一个性情忧郁的男孩
An often temporary state of mind; a mood:心情,情绪:通常是暂时性的一种精神状态;情绪:例句:I`m in no humor to argue.我不想争论
A sudden, unanticipated whim.See Synonyms at mood 突发的念头:一个突然的、未预料到的念头参见 moodCapricious or peculiar behavior.任性:任性的或怪僻的行为v.tr.(及物动词)hu.mored,hu.mor.ing,hu.mors To comply with the wishes or ideas of; indulge.迎合,迁就:按照(某人的)希望或打算;放纵To adapt or accommodate oneself to.See Synonyms at pamper 使自己适应参见 pamper
<习惯用语>out of humor
In a bad mood; irritable.情绪不好的;易发怒的习惯用语>来源:Middle English [fluid] 中古英语 [流体] from Old French umor 源自 古法语 umor from Latin ômor 源自 拉丁语 ômor
